Update: Missing child alert -- Wiley Wolf is missing and believed to be at risk (Photo) - 07/20/23

UPDATE NOTE: Attached to this update is a more recent photo of Molly Miraina Wolf taken on July 14. 

(Salem) – Wiley Wolf, a newborn infant, went missing with his mother Molly Miraina Wolf and father Alex Hatten Walter Wolf III from Portland on July 16. The Oregon Department of Human Services (ODHS), Child Welfare Division believes that he may be at risk and is searching for Wiley to assess his safety.

ODHS asks the public to help in the effort to find Wiley. Anyone who suspects they have information about the location of Wiley, Molly Miraina Wolf or Alex Hatten Walter Wolf III should call 911. 

They frequently spend time at the Motel 6 in Troutdale and may be in the Portland or Vancouver area. They may also be traveling out of state beyond the Portland and Vancouver area.

Sometimes when a child is missing they may be in significant danger and ODHS may need to locate them to assess and support their safety. As ODHS works to do everything it can to find these missing children and assess their safety, media alerts will be issued in some circumstances when it is determined necessary. Sometimes, in these situations, a child may go missing repeatedly, resulting in more than one media alert for the same child.

Report child abuse to the Oregon Child Abuse Hotline by calling 1-855-503-SAFE (7233).  This toll-free number allows you to report abuse of any child or adult to the Oregon Department of Human Services, 24 hours a day, seven days a week and 365 days a year.
